终极对比:本地部署vs云端Z-Image-Turbo镜像,哪种方式更适合你的项目?
作为技术负责人,当你计划为团队引入Z-Image-Turbo这类AI图像生成能力时,第一个关键决策就是:选择本地部署还是云端服务?本文将全面分析两种方案的优缺点,帮助你根据项目需求做出最优选择。Z-Image-Turbo作为阿里通义实验室开源的6B参数图像生成模型,以其8步快速推理和16GB显存即可运行的特性,成为当前AI绘图领域的热门选择。这类任务通常需要GPU环境,目前CSDN算力平台提供了包含该镜像的预置环境,可快速部署验证。
本地部署方案深度解析
硬件与软件需求
本地部署Z-Image-Turbo需要满足以下基础条件:
- 显卡要求:最低需NVIDIA显卡(6GB显存可运行基础功能,16GB显存可获得更好体验)
- 系统环境:
- Ubuntu 20.04+/Windows 10+
- CUDA 11.7+
- Python 3.8+
- 存储空间:模型文件约12GB,建议预留20GB空间
典型部署流程
安装基础依赖:
bash conda create -n zimage python=3.8 conda activate zimage pip install torch torchvision torchaudio --index-url https://download.pytorch.org/whl/cu117下载模型权重:
bash git clone https://github.com/modelscope/z-image-turbo.git cd z-image-turbo启动ComfyUI服务:
bash python main.py --port 7860 --listen
本地部署的优势
- 数据隐私性强:所有数据留在本地
- 长期成本可控:一次性硬件投入后无持续费用
- 定制灵活:可自由修改模型和工作流
本地部署的挑战
- 前期准备复杂:需要手动配置CUDA、Python等环境
- 硬件投入大:高性能显卡采购成本高
- 维护成本高:需专人负责系统升级和故障排查
云端Z-Image-Turbo镜像方案详解
云端部署核心优势
- 快速启动:预装环境,无需配置依赖
- 弹性资源:按需使用GPU,避免硬件闲置
- 免维护:由云平台负责系统更新和安全补丁
典型使用流程
- 选择预置Z-Image-Turbo镜像
- 启动实例(通常1-3分钟完成)
- 通过Web UI或API立即使用
资源消耗对比
| 场景 | 显存占用 | 推理时间 | 并发能力 | |--------------|----------|----------|----------| | 本地RTX 3060 | 10-12GB | 1.2s | 1-2请求 | | 云端T4 | 15GB | 0.8s | 5-8请求 |
关键决策因素对比
成本结构分析
- 本地部署:
- 初始成本:显卡(¥5000-20000)+服务器(¥3000+)
持续成本:电费+维护人力
云端服务:
- 按小时计费(约¥2-10/小时)
- 无硬件折旧风险
适用场景建议
- 选择本地部署当:
- 项目周期>1年
- 有严格数据合规要求
已有现成GPU资源
选择云端镜像当:
- 需要快速验证原型
- 团队缺乏运维能力
- 需求存在波动性
实战建议与常见问题
性能优化技巧
本地部署时:
python # 在启动脚本中添加这些参数可提升10-15%性能 export PYTORCH_CUDA_ALLOC_CONF=max_split_size_mb:32云端使用时:
- 选择配备Tensor Core的GPU型号(如T4/V100)
- 启用自动缩放功能应对流量波动
典型错误处理
CUDA版本不匹配:
bash # 查看CUDA版本 nvcc --version # 重新安装对应版本 conda install cudatoolkit=11.7显存不足报错:
- 降低生成分辨率(从1024x1024→512x512)
- 使用
--medvram参数启动
总结与行动指南
经过对比分析,我的建议是:对于短期项目或技术验证阶段,优先使用云端Z-Image-Turbo镜像快速启动;当项目进入稳定运营期且生成量较大时,再考虑迁移到本地部署。实际操作中,你可以:
- 先用云端环境验证业务场景可行性
- 记录典型工作负载的资源消耗数据
- 基于实际数据计算TCO(总拥有成本)
- 做出最终部署决策
无论选择哪种方案,Z-Image-Turbo都能为团队提供业界领先的图像生成能力。现在就可以尝试在云端启动一个实例,体验8步出图的惊人效率。